JAMES SMITH S LIFE AMONG THE DELAWARES, 1755 1759 James Smith, pioneer, was born in Franklin county, Pennsylvania, in 1737. When he was eighteen years of age he was captured by the Indians, was adopted into one of their tribes, and lived with them as one of themselves until his escape in 1759. Captives Among the Indians Contents Colonel James Smith s life among the Delawares, 1755 1759 Father Bressani s captivity among the Iroquois, 1644 Captivity of Mrs. Mary Rowlandson among the Indians of Massachusetts, 1676 Capture and escape of Mercy Harbison, 1792.
